Transaction d81230eab57836a9b262bef193fc39613ad14cb98f16d5daf8dc484b34363120
1 Input
1 Output
-
d81230eab57836a9b262bef193fc39613ad14cb98f16d5daf8dc484b34363120:0
- value
- 99787
- script pubkey
- OP_0 OP_PUSHBYTES_20 e61f32073142b14224601f0b6f9ba257f71b0d0b
- address
- bc1quc0nype3g2c5yfrqru9klxaz2lm3krgtr72srr